| Product Type | Video Projector |
| Brand | Sharp |
| Model | A155U |
| Projection Technology | DLP with single 0.55" DMD chip |
| Native Resolution | 1920 x 1080 (Full HD) |
| Brightness | 3200 ANSI lumens |
| Contrast Ratio | 20000:1 (Dynamic) |
| Aspect Ratio | 16:9 native, compatible with 4:3 |
| Lamp Type | 240W UHP lamp |
| Lamp Life | Up to 5000 hours (Normal), 10000 hours (Eco) |
| Projection Lens | F = 2.5 - 2.7, f = 21.9 - 24.0 mm, manual zoom and focus |
| Throw Ratio | 1.5 - 1.7:1 |
| Keystone Correction | +/- 40° vertical, +/- 40° horizontal |
| Built-in Speaker | 10W mono |
| Inputs | 2x HDMI, 1x VGA (D-Sub 15-pin), 1x Composite Video, 1x S-Video, 1x USB Type-A, 1x Audio 3.5mm |
| Outputs | 1x VGA (Monitor out), 1x Audio 3.5mm |
| Network | RJ45 LAN for control and presentation |
| Dimensions (W x D x H) | 315 x 245 x 95 mm (without feet) |
| Weight | 3.2 kg |
| Power Consumption | 280W (Normal), 210W (Eco), Standby < 0.5W |
| Power Supply | AC 100-240V, 50/60Hz |
| Noise Level | 32 dB (Normal), 28 dB (Eco) |
| Maintenance | Air filter cleanable, lamp user-replaceable |
| Safety Features | Overheat protection, auto power-off after no signal, key lock |
| Spare Parts Availability | Replacement lamp module (part no. AN-P240LP), filter (part no. AN-F215X) |
Frequently Asked Questions - A155U SHARP
How do I replace the lamp on the Sharp A155U projector?
First, turn off the projector and unplug it. Wait for the lamp to cool completely. Then, using a screwdriver, remove the lamp cover located on the side. Unscrew the two screws holding the lamp module, carefully pull the lamp out, and insert the new one. Replace the screws and the cover, then reset the lamp timer via the menu under Maintenance > Reset Lamp Hours.
What is the recommended projection distance for a 100-inch screen?
To achieve a 100-inch diagonal 16:9 image, place the projector at a distance of 3.3 to 3.8 meters from the screen, based on the throw ratio of 1.5 - 1.7. Use the zoom adjustment to fine-tune the image size.
How can I connect my laptop to the Sharp A155U?
Use an HDMI cable if your laptop has an HDMI output, or a VGA cable for older models. Connect the cable to the corresponding input on the projector, then press the Source button on the remote control to select HDMI or VGA. If no image appears, set your laptop to extend or duplicate the display via the display settings.
The image is flickering or unstable. What should I do?
Check the signal source and cable connection first. Try a different cable or port. Make sure the refresh rate on your computer is set to 60Hz. Also verify that the resolution matches the projector's native resolution (1920x1080) for the sharpest image. If the problem persists, reset the projector to factory defaults.
Can I mount the A155U projector on a ceiling?
Yes, the A155U supports ceiling mounting. Use a standard projector mount compatible with the 3 mounting points on the bottom. After installation, go to Settings > Projection > Ceiling Mount and select Front Ceiling to flip the image vertically and horizontally.
What is the best picture mode for watching movies?
For a cinematic experience, select Cinema or Movie mode from the Picture menu. This adjusts color temperature, brightness, and contrast to closely match the D65 standard used in film production. Turn off any Dynamic Contrast or Eco Mode to avoid flickering in dark scenes.
How often should I clean the air filter?
Clean the air filter every 500 hours of use or after every 3 months, whichever comes first. Open the filter cover on the side, remove the filter, and clean it with a vacuum cleaner. If the filter is very dirty, you can rinse it with water and let it dry completely before reinstalling. Never operate the projector without the filter installed.
Why does my Sharp A155U shut off automatically?
Automatic shutdown is usually due to overheating or power interruptions. Check that air vents and the filter are clean and not blocked. Ensure the ambient temperature is below 35°C (95°F). Also, the lamp may have reached its end of life; replace it if the lamp indicator is illuminated. The projector also has an auto off feature that activates after a period of inactivity without input.
Can I connect the projector to a network for remote control?
Yes, the A155U has an RJ45 LAN port. Connect it to your network router with an Ethernet cable. Then, use the projector's network settings to assign an IP address. You can then control the projector via a web browser or using the Sharp projector management software, enabling remote power on/off, status monitoring, and firmware updates.
What is the correct way to reset the lamp hour counter?
After replacing the lamp, reset the counter to ensure accurate maintenance tracking. Go to the Installation or Maintenance menu, select Lamp Life, and choose Reset Lamp Timer. Confirm the action. The counter will zero out, and the lamp warning message will disappear.
